Is historical fiction the same as realistic fiction?
Not exactly. Historical fiction is based on past eras and might have fictional elements added to make the story more engaging. Realistic fiction is all about representing current or recent times as accurately as possible without too much fictionalization.

Is Little Women historical fiction or realistic fiction?
Little Women is more of a realistic fiction. It portrays the lives and experiences of the March sisters in a relatable and down-to-earth way.

What are the characteristics of historical realistic fiction?
Historical realistic fiction typically has accurate historical details. Writers do a lot of research to make sure things like the clothing, the language, and the customs of the time are correct. The characters in this type of fiction are complex and believable. They have the same hopes, fears, and desires as real people in that historical period. Also, the themes often deal with timeless human issues, but they are presented within the context of the historical time, such as love and loss during a time of great social change.

What are the characteristics of realistic historical fiction?
The main characteristics include authenticity. The story should be firmly rooted in historical facts. It may explore the social, political, and cultural aspects of the era. For instance, a story set during the Industrial Revolution might show the working conditions of the factory workers. It also has the ability to make the past come alive. By creating vivid descriptions of the environment, it allows readers to understand what life was like in the past. It can also offer different perspectives on historical events, making readers think about how things could have been different.

Is 'The Book Thief' realistic or historical fiction?
It is historical fiction. The story is set during World War II in Germany, a specific historical period. It weaves together fictional characters and events within the framework of real historical events like the bombing of Munich, the persecution of Jews, etc. It gives a vivid picture of that era from the perspective of a young girl, Liesel. Although the characters are fictional, they are used to explore and represent the real experiences and emotions of people during that time.

What is the difference between historical fiction and realistic fiction?
Historical fiction is set in the past and often includes real events or people but with fictional elements. Realistic fiction, on the other hand, is set in the present or a contemporary setting and portrays events and characters that could happen in real life.
